4. Use guidelines
The insecticide lamp is designed for exterminating flying
insects that are lured by light. Lured insects are killed by
electric shock. The device can be suspended on the ceiling,
shelf or free-standing. The device must not be used outside
of buildings.

4.2 Preparing for use
The device should be used only in closed rooms and
protected from weather conditions.
The temperature of environment must not be higher than
40°C and the relative humidity should be less than 85%.
Ensure good ventilation in the room in which the device
is used. The distance between each side of the device and
the wall or other objects should be at least 10 cm. Keep the
device away from hot surfaces.
